Small point of fact. It's 4 weeks until the release date. We have to
have things composed and staged to mirrors nearly a week prior to that,
and thus in RC stage a few days before that. You most certainly do not
have 4 weeks of bugfixing left. I'd prefer all changes are done by Nov
10th so that we can enter the RC stage and only pick up changes that
would prevent the release of Fedora 12.

Fedora 12 was a compressed release, we knew that creating the schedule
and going into the release. That means we have to cut some corners and
make some sacrifices in order to get back to our May day / Halloween
schedule.
